欢迎来到天天文库
浏览记录
ID:33440340
大小:11.91 MB
页数:96页
时间:2019-02-26
《具有jtag调试功能的minisys-1a处理器的设计与实现》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库。
1、DESIGN舳IMPLEMENTATION万方数据OFMINISYS一1APROCESSOR、入ⅡTHJTAGDEBUGGINGFEATUI迮SADissertationSubmittedtoSoutheastUniversityFortheProfessionalDegreeofMasterofEngineeringBYBMWei-yaSupervisedby≥iupervlsedbyAssociateProf.YANGQuart—shengSchoolofComputerScienceandEngineeringSoutheastUniversityJu
2、ne2014万方数据东南大学学位论文独创性声明本人声明所呈交的学位论文是我个人在导师指导下进行的研究工作及取得的研究成果。尽我所知,除了文中特别加以标注和致谢的地方外,论文中不包含其他人已经发表或撰写过的研究成果,也不包含为获得东南大学或其它教育机构的学位或证书而使用过的材料。与我一同工作的同志对本研究所做的任何贡献均已在论文中作了明确的说明并表示了谢意。研究生签名:』主!垒盘兰日期:21兰:』!≥东南大学学位论文使用授权声明东南大学、中国科学技术信息研究所、国家图书馆有权保留本人所送交学位论文的复印件和电子文档,可以采用影印、缩印或其他复制手段保存论文。本
3、人电子文档的内容和纸质论文的内容相一致。除在保密期内的保密论文外,允许论文被查阅和借阅,可以公布(包括以电子信息形式刊登)论文的全部内容或中、英文摘要等部分内容。论文的公布(包括以电子信息形式刊登)授权东南大学研究生院办理。研究生签名/丑垒垂里导师签名:琏鲞堕堑L日期:型、)万方数据摘要当前,SoC设计领域的竞争日趋激烈。开发自主的处理器核、核心IP以及总线架构,将使我国的SoC发展更具竞争力。国内不少研究所和高校都在研制开发自主的SoC,东南大学也不例外。经过多年的努力,东南大学计算机学院开发出了一种嵌入式SoC系统——MI血Sys。它采用了MIPS32位
4、指令集中的31条指令,包含一个以32位RISC型流水处理器、七种简单的接口以及相关白鲧统软件。本文针对MiniSys的三个关键问题展开,设计并实现了MiniSys-lA系统,重点研究了基于JTAG的调试系统。首先,本文制订了MiniSys一1A指令集,设计并实现了基于该指令集的MiniSys.1ACPU。该CPU包含多周期专用乘除法运算模块,弥补了其处理乘除运算方面的缺失。其次,本文设计并实现了一个专用的SDRAM控制器。它能够完成对SDRAM的初始化、读、写、刷新、预充的操作,实现了对SDRAM的控制,扩大了存储器存储空间。最后,本文设计并实现了基于JTA
5、G的调试系统。该调试系统与MiniSys一1ACPU、MiniSys-1ABUS相结合,可以读写MiniSys一1ACPU内部寄存器,可以读写MiniSys.1A存储器。整个系统使用Quartus9.1开发,乘除法运算单元和调试系统通过了仿真测试,SDRAM控制器模块通过了下载测试。测试结果表明上述功能符合预期。关键字:MiniSys.1A,乘除法运算单元,SDRAM控制器,调试系统万方数据AbstractAtpresent,therearefiercecompetitionsinSoCdesign.Itisveryimportantforourcountr
6、ytodevelopindependentprocessorcore,IPcoreandbusarchitecture.Inthatcase,thedevelopmentofSoCdesigninOurcountrywillbecomemorecompetitive.ManyresearchinstitutesandcollegesaledevelopingtheirownSoC,includingSoutheastUniversity.ComputerScienceandEngineeringCollegeofSEUhavedevelopedaSoCemb
7、eddedsystemcalledMiniSysuntilnow.Ituses31instructionsofMIPS32.-bitInstructionSet,includinga32··bitRISCpipelineprocessor,sevensimpleinterfacesandrelatedsystemsoftware.Inthisthesis,threekeyissuesofMiniSysarediscussedandtheMiniSys一1Asystemisdesigned.ThedebuggingsystembasingOilJTAGisth
8、eemphasis.Firstofall,MiniS
此文档下载收益归作者所有